The importance of herpes viruses in equine medicine, with special attention to the population of Iranian horses
The viral diseases can be lead to considerable losses to horse breeding industry. Equine herpesviruses are one of the most important groups of viruses which can cause diseases in horse. In recent years, some of herpesvirus diseases were suspected in Iran. Therefore, the recognition of different aspects of disorders that cause by these viruses can be useful. Five different herpesviruses have been associated with diseases of horses. EHV-1, EHV-3 and EHV-4 are alphaherpesviruses whereas EHV-2 and EHV-5 are gammaherpsviruses. The most epidemiological features of infection with these viruses are similar. For example, they are endemic in horse populations worldwide. Also, there is lifelong latency of infection with periodic reactivation of virus shedding. The disorders cause be equine herpesviruses have various manifestation: Upper respiratory tract disease is caused principally by EHV-4, although disease attributable to EHV-1 occurs. EHV-2 cause respiratory disease, including pneumonia of foals. Equine multinodular pulmonary fibrosis (EMPF) is attributable to EHV-5. Abortion is almost always associated with EHV-1, although rare sporadic cases are associated with EHV-4. Perinatal disease of foals is associated with EHV-1. Myeloencephalopathy is associated with EHV-1 and rarely EHV-4. The cause of coital exanthema is EHV-3. The diagnosis of diseases cause by equine herpesviruses can establish by virological tests, i.e. PCR. Although, there is no specific treatment for this group of diseases, the symptomatic and supportive treatment is advisable
